What is Cedarwood Essential Oil?

Cedarwood essential oil is a substance derived from the needles, leaves, bark, and berries of cedar trees.



Benefits of Cedarwood Essential Oil

Cedarwood essential oil helps fight Acne, relieving stress and anxiety and promoting better sleep.




